Welcome to the Amherst Police Department website! The Amherst Police Department is a team of 47 sworn and 14 civilian employees including those in the Communications Center. The Success of the Amherst Police Department is due both to the strong commitment of our employees and to the support they receive from the community. We value the trust placed in us by the community that we serve, and we will be diligent in our efforts to uphold that trust. We continue to identify new and innovative ways to address crime and quality of life concerns and we welcome input from the community to assist us towards that goal. I hope that you can see the exceptional service that the Amherst Police Department provides, and I hope that you will take advantage our many services and programs.

The Amherst Police Department (APD) values the dedication and integrity of all members of the Department. APD values the diversity of the Amherst community and is grateful for its support and partnership. APD strives to protect the safety, rights, and property of every person within the Town of Amherst. APD holds itself to the highest professional and ethical standards.
This mission statement is the product of a focus group of Amherst Police officers and members of our community. The agency is very proud of the work that we do and how we maintain the standards within the statement.
